Output 132eb8c1b6a9981343092b23ac92ba6a6f198f35328f1e6d1740aa8e9c630781:1

value
25935810
script pubkey
OP_0 OP_PUSHBYTES_20 456bfc51ea052275e50205256a27a2e687e60f3b
address
bc1qg44lc502q538tegzq5jk5fazu6r7vrem92sfnj
transaction
132eb8c1b6a9981343092b23ac92ba6a6f198f35328f1e6d1740aa8e9c630781
confirmations
412623
spent
true